Bernard P. Herber

Professor Emeritus

Areas of Expertise
  • Public economics
  • International public finance

Selected Research Papers

  • “Protecting the Antarctic Commons: Economic Efficiency Issues,” International Atlantic Economic Society, Chicago, October 2004.
  • “Tax Instruments, User Charges, and the Internalization of International Environmental Externalities,” International Atlantic Economic Society, Charleston, SC, October 2000.
  • “Public Finance Beyond Nations: The New International Public Finance,” Spanish Public Finance Conference, University of Salamanca, February 1995.
  • “International Environmental Taxation in the Absence of Sovereignty,” Working Paper of the International Monetary Fund, December 1992, WP/92/104.

Selected Publications

Journal Articles

  • “International Taxation: Economic Merits and Political Obstacles,” International Jorrnal of Evelopment Planning Literature, Vol. 13, No. 2, 1998.
  • “Pigovian Taxation at the Supranational Level: Fiscal Provisions of the International Oil Pollution Compensation Fund,” Journal of Environment and Development, Vol. 6, No. 2, 1997.
  • “An International Carbon Tax to Combat Global Warming: An Economic and Political Analysis of the European Union Proposal,” with Jose Raga, American Journal of Economics and Sociology, Vol. 54, No. 3, 1995.
  • “The Economic Case for an Antarctic World Park in Light of Recent Policy Developments,” Polar Record, Vol. 28, No. 167, 1992.
  • “Mining or World Park? A Politico-Economic Analysis of Alternative Land Use Regimes in Antarctica,” Natural Resources Journal, Vol. 31, No. 4, 1991.
  • “The Economic Case for an International Law of the Atmosphere,” Environment and Planning: Government and Policy, Vol. 9, 1991.

Books

  • Public Finance and Public Debt, ed., Wayne State University Press: 1986.
  • Modern Public Finance, 5 th edition, Irwin: 1983

Chapters in Books

  • “Innovative Financial Mechanisms for Sustainable Development: Overcoming the Political Obstacles to International Taxation,” in Finance for Sustainable Development, United Nations, 1997.
  • “The International Public Goods of Antarctica: A New Politico-Economic Regime for the World’s Seventh Continent?”, in Public Finance, Trade, and Development, Vito Tanzi, ed., Wayne State University Press, 1990.
  • “Personal Income Taxation under Federalism: Vertical and Horizontal Fiscal Balance Effects,” in Taxation and Federalism: Essays in Honor of Russell Mathews, G. Brennan, B. Grewal, and P. Groenewegen, eds., Pergamon: Australian National University, 1988.
  • “The State and Redistribution: An Historical Look at Egalitarianism in the United States ,” in Public Sector and Political Economy Today, H. Hanusch, K. Roskamp, and J. Wiseman (eds.), Gustav Fischer Verlag, 1985.
